在Pandas中,可以使用inspect
模块来找到方法的源代码。下面是一种方法:
首先,导入inspect
模块:
import inspect
然后,使用inspect.getsource()
函数来获取方法的源代码。例如,如果要查找DataFrame
类中的head()
方法的源代码,可以按照以下步骤进行:
import pandas as pd
# 创建一个示例DataFrame
df = pd.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})
# 使用inspect.getsource()函数获取方法的源代码
source_code = inspect.getsource(df.head)
# 打印源代码
print(source_code)
运行上述代码,将会输出head()
方法的源代码。
请注意,inspect.getsource()
函数只能获取到Python代码中可用的源代码,对于使用C或其他语言实现的底层方法,将无法获取到源代码。
Pandas是一个功能强大的数据处理和分析库,适用于数据清洗、转换、分析和可视化等各种数据操作场景。它提供了高效的数据结构和数据处理工具,使得数据分析变得更加简单和高效。
腾讯云提供了云计算服务,其中包括云服务器、云数据库、云存储等多种产品,可以满足不同场景下的需求。具体的产品介绍和相关链接地址可以在腾讯云官方网站上找到。
领取专属 10元无门槛券
手把手带您无忧上云